Hwam 2610

Another stove from the Hwam range has made it into our top 10. In at number 4 is the Hwam 2610. This stove is one for you if you are looking for a smaller sized stove for a smaller sized room. It may be compact in size but this does not stop Hwam packing it with all the beauty and up to date modern technology that customers like you look for. With the curved sides, side hinged doors and discrete handles, the 2610 oozes style, sophistication and class. Alongside the stunning looks it has a fantastic brand new feature, the Autopilot HIS system. This system means that you don't have to control the air supply to the firebox manually; it does it for you so you can try and keep your room at a steady temperature during the day and night. Now all this packed into a compact stove makes it not surprising why this stove ranks so high in our top 10 best sellers.

ACR Rowandale

We are nearly to the top and the next stove to get us closer is the ACR Rowandale. Like many of the stoves in our countdown, this stove is suited to a small to medium sized room due to the 5kW heat output. The 5kW output is very popular because if you go any bigger it then requires more work when installing. Not only does this stove have a panoramic door where you can view your roaring flames from but it also has the magnificent Airwash system that will keep it clean and clear so you don't have to worry about it. Alongside all the stunning looks and great features, you can also make this stove your own with the choice of four colours, matt black, buttermilk, majolica brown or gloss black enamel.
